Hello.
I was just wondering if there was anyone out there who knew the Triste family tree.

Ahar's says that there was Triste who taught/trained: Aric, Tatiana, Pandora, and Ramsey. On another tree I saw there was also Rikai and Jillian Red, as if they were also students. (Quick ?: Was the original Triste a male or female?)

Then it says that Aric and Tatiana had no students, which I agree on. And then Pandora and Ramsey. Ahar's tree said that Pandora taught Jesse Fontes, Eric Marinitch, Adijila, Rikai, Alexander Weatere, and Christian Denmark. The only thing that confuses me is Rikai. Where does he/she fit in all this? Was she taught by Triste or by Pandora?

And lastly, Jillian Red, was she taught by Triste or did she learn from Ramsey?

And just clarifying things: How is Jesse Fontes related to Dinah Alina?
Did Adjila start Bruja and how is she related to Larissa?
And how is Rikai related to Jenna?

I know its a lot to digest, but thanks for your patience.

Fallen, the current family tree located on The Den of Shadows is pretty accurate when it comes to the Tristes. It should sort out all the relationship/training questions:

http://www.tdos.org/3world/familytree.php

Click the + and - symbols to expand/collapse the tree. If you can't see them, you may need to change to a color scheme with a non-black background.

It sounds from your questions like you've already read it, so I'll just iterate... the tree is pretty accurate.

Quote:
Then it says that Aric and Tatiana had no students, which I agree on.


Actually she has tons, just few that survived or were noteworthy, and hence I didn't put any on the tree.

Quote:
The only thing that confuses me is Rikai. Where does he/she fit in all this? Was she taught by Triste or by Pandora?


Rikai confuses a lot of people. No one knows who taught her.

Quote:
Did Adjila start Bruja and how is she related to Larissa?


Among other things, Adjila is a man. Just for the record.
